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Extraction in Dedham, MA
Don’t ignore these warning signs, or you might end up with costly repairs and a bigger mess on your hands. Catching water damage early is key to a successful restoration.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your attic that won’t go away, it’s a sign that there’s excess moisture in the area. Don’t ignore this warning sign or you might end up with mold growth and health risks.
Water Stains on Insulation
Water stains on your insulation are a clear sign that there’s water damage in your attic. Don’t delay in addressing this issue or you might end up with costly repairs and a bigger mess on your hands.
Warped or Buckled Ceiling Tiles
Warped or buckled ceiling tiles are a sign that there’s water damage in your attic. Don’t ignore this warning sign or you might end up with a bigger mess on your hands.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per is a sign that there’s excess moisture in the area. Don’t delay in addressing this issue or you might end up with costly repairs and a bigger mess on your hands.
Unexplained Noise or Leaks
Unexplained noise or leaks in your attic are a sign that there’s water damage in the area. Don’t ignore this warning sign or you might end up with costly repairs and a bigger mess on your hands.

Common Questions About Attic Water Extraction
Q: What causes water damage in attics?
A: Water damage in attics can be caused by various factors, including roof leaks, ice dams, condensation, and poor ventilation. We’ll work with you to identify the source of the damage and create a customized drying plan to prevent future occurrences.
